N.J. Stat. § 48:5-20: Uses of bridge

Every bridge constructed under the provisions of this article may be used for the passage of vehicles of all types and kind; for the passage of pedestrians; for all incidental purposes, including conduits, cables, pipes, wires and railways, in so far as such use will not interfere with the passage of vehicles and pedestrians.
